削弱震荡节点的LDPC码译码算法研究

Research on decoding algorithm for LDPC codes to weaken oscillating nodes

  • 摘要: 为了进一步提高动态调度算法的误码性能,提出一种基于变量节点消息震荡的残差置信传播(Residual Belief Propagation based on Variable Nodes message Oscillation phenomenon ,VNO-RBP)算法。该算法以面向节点的残差置信传播(Node-Wise RBP ,NW-RBP)算法为基础,当译码器出现震荡后,以变量节点消息LLR(Log Likelihood Ratio)值的相对可靠度作为参考,选择相对残差值较大的节点优先更新,加快译码收敛速度。同时,选取译码过程中产生的震荡节点作为目标节点,将目标节点前后两次迭代中的LLR值作加权平均处理,降低该节点的不可靠度。理论分析及仿真结果表明,本文提出的VNO-RBP译码算法比NW-RBP算法复杂度更低,在误码率为10-5时误码性能提升大约0.31dB。

     

    Abstract: In order to improve the BER performance of dynamic scheduling algorithm, the VNO-RBP(based on VN message oscillation of RBP) algorithm was proposed in this paper.This algorithm was based on the NW-RBP algorithm,when the decoder began to oscillate, we would select the nodes with larger residual that need prior updating by making reference to the relative reliability of variable nodes in the process of decoding so as to speed the decoding speed.At the same time, selecting the target nodes that arise oscillation ,executing weighted mean processing to LLR values generated before and after updating so as to reduce the unreliability of variable nodes. The theoretical analysis and simulation results demonstrate that compared with NW-RBP algorithm,the proposed VNO-RBP decoding algorithm has lower decoding complexity and its BER performance improves 0.31dB when the error rate reaches 10-5.

     

/

返回文章
返回